Battery Health Tab Missing

My Macbook Pro Retina mid-2012 does not show the battery health tab after the macOS Catalina 10.15.5 update. Is this feature not supported on older MacBooks? That would be sad, as I think we would need this feature most! My MacBook sits at full charge quite a bit during video conference calls, which makes the whole system quite warm. Am I missing something?

I believe you need at least a 2016 MacBook Pro, apparently new hardware technology is needed. Not available on my 2015 Apple laptops either. Apple should state which models work with this feature, their support page for this feature doesn't mention models
